== Makasar ==
=== Etymology ===
From pa- + siballaʼ (“to live together”).
=== Verb ===
pasiballaʼ (Lontara spelling ᨄᨔᨗᨅᨒ or 𑻣𑻰𑻳𑻤𑻮)
(transitive) to make people live together in one house
(transitive, figurative) to combine two habits; to be accustomed to doing both things together
